ReadyNAS 628x won’t power on
This unit had been running flawlessly for years but it was time to retire it.
The plan was to relocate it to make the data transfer more efficient, but when I went to power it down the power button on the front didn’t bring up the graceful shutdown. Without thinking straight I logged in via the IP and shut it down.
Relocated it, plugged it in, but the power button on the front didn’t switch it on. Assuming it was just a broken switch, I stripped the wires and bridged them but no luck.
Any thoughts on how to force it to power on or how else to get the data off?

Something to try for anyone else experiencing this issue in the future. Check the main board 2032 Battery. I have a RN626XE4-100NES that I haven't used in about a year, but it was working perfectly when it was last used. I plugged it in, and the only indication of power I got was the LED light on the LAN connection. (I tried every diag trick, nothing worked.) Then I took it apart to try and get the model of the power supply. Saw the 2032 battery and pulled it out to test. 2.9v. Got a new one, installed, connected everything back together... And it fired right up, just like normal.
